A Strabane dentist has been struck off by the General Dental Council (GDC) after being found guilty of practising without professional indemnity cover, providing inadequate treatment and making inappropriate claims for treatment.

Donal Joseph McEnhill of Eden Terrace in Strabane, Co Tyrone, was found to have been practising without indemnity from December 2006 until April 20ı4 when representatives from the Health and Social Care Board attended his practice and advised him to stop treating patients immediately. During this visit, McEnhill told the representatives that he was not indemnified and did not intend to renew his cover as he was retiring in eight days time.

He was also found guilty of several clinical failings including failing to make any, or any adequate, record of medical histories or medical history updates for eight patients as well as failing to take radiographs when clinically indicated for the same cohort of patients. Other failings included inappropriately prescribed antibiotics, failure to diagnose caries, and making inappropriate claims for treatment.

The PCC’s determination read: “His repeated acts of dishonesty, and the substantial periods over which he practised without having appropriate professional indemnity cover, are so serious and damaging to the reputation of the profession that the only sufficient and proportionate sanction in this case is that of erasure.

“The totality of the misconduct was so serious that it is fundamentally incompatible with continued registration.”
